Celebrate small victories along the way from "summary" of The Art of Habit Building by Dan Stevens

When embarking on the journey of habit building, it is essential to remember the importance of acknowledging and celebrating small victories along the way. These small wins serve as stepping stones towards your larger goals and can provide a sense of accomplishment and motivation that propels you forward. By recognizing and appreciating these incremental achievements, you are reinforcing positive behavior and reinforcing the habit you are trying to establish. Celebrating small victories also helps to break down the overall goal into more manageable chunks. Instead of focusing solely on the end result, you can shift your attention to the progress you have made so far. This shift in perspective can help to alleviate feelings of overwhelm or frustration that may arise when tackling a challenging habit. By celebrating each small triumph, you are able to stay motivated and committed to the habit-building process. Moreover, celebrating small victories can help to cultivate a sense of gratitude and mindfulness in your daily life. By taking the time to acknowledge and celebrate your achievements, you are fostering a positive mindset and creating space for joy and appreciation. This mindset shift can have a ripple effect on other areas of your life, leading to increased happiness and overall well-being. In addition, celebrating small victories can help to reinforce the neural pathways associated with your desired habit. Each time you acknowledge and celebrate a small win, you are strengthening the connections in your brain that support that particular behavior. This repetitive reinforcement can make it easier to maintain the habit over time, as your brain becomes more accustomed to the new pattern of behavior.
  1. Celebrating small victories along the way is a powerful tool in the habit-building process. By recognizing and appreciating your progress, breaking down your goals into manageable chunks, cultivating gratitude and mindfulness, and reinforcing neural pathways, you can set yourself up for success in establishing lasting habits. So remember to take the time to celebrate each small win, no matter how seemingly insignificant it may be, as it is these victories that will ultimately lead you to your desired outcome.
